And So the Journey Begins
Well, I've been spending the last couple of months and am currently working as a lighting intern at the awesome Cuppa Coffee Studios, working on the new show Glenn Martin, DDS. It is a great, eye-opening experience into the world of professional, stop-motion production; not to mention, an excellent resource of knowledge and insight into the film that lies ahead of me.
